Prime Minister Drnovšek Begins His Visit in Australia

Canberra, 4 June - DRNOVŠEK/AUSTRALIA
Slovene Prime Minister Janez Drnovšek, on several days' visit in Australia, on Thursday with his Australian counterpart John Howard and Deputy Prime Minister Tim Fisher, who is also minister of trade, and Governor General Sir William Dean. In the evening Prime Minister Drnovšek will attend a dinner given by Australian Foreign Minister Alexander Downer. The talks centered on bilateral cooperation, especially in economic field, and exchange of views on international issues, the STA has learnt from sources in the Slovene delegation. This includes also Vojka Ravbar, state secretary in the Ministry of Economic Relations and Development.
